Abstract

Under direction of a machine controller, a traversing shuttle automatically selects one component along a plurality of radially leaded components stored on continuous component belts, centers the component, shears the selected component from the belt, and conveys the component to a pivotable insertion head. The insertion head clamps onto the component leads, pivots and inserts the component leads into predrilled holes in a positioned printed circuit board. A mechanism beneath the board, cuts the leads and clinches the shortened leads to the board. The board is repositioned and another radial lead component of the same or different type and electrical size is selected and the cycle is repeated. Different spacings of components on the storage belts and different lead spacings are automatically accommodated.
